This paper addresses two important aspects in the area of RFID technology namely, development of platform tolerant tags and RFID tags and systems in medicine. Firstly, platform tolerant tag designs are discussed. A dual patch/fat folded-dipole type tags (for human monitoring) is described and measurements are performed to validate the performance of the tag in different environments including human body and metals. Then, a medicine monitoring system is briefly discussed which can prove vital for medical compliance. The concept of the tagging of each medicine pill with RFID tag is presented and its design is discussed including proper operability within the human body.
